Mr. Stephen C. Schoettmer is a lawyer practicing business, contracts, labor-employment and 3 other areas of law. Stephen received a A.B. degree from Duke University in 1976, and has been licensed for 46 years. Stephen practices at Thompson & Knight LLP in Dallas, TX.
